feat(doctor): add system diagnostics feature

This commit is contained in:
Will Miao
2026-04-11 16:02:13 +08:00
parent 25fa175aa2
commit 1817142a7b
28 changed files with 2231 additions and 6 deletions

View File

@@ -1806,6 +1806,35 @@
"moveFailed": "Failed to move item: {message}"
}
},
"doctor": {
"kicker": "Diagnostics système",
"title": "Docteur",
"buttonTitle": "Lancer les diagnostics et les corrections courantes",
"loading": "Vérification de l'environnement...",
"footer": "Exportez un lot de diagnostic si le problème persiste après la réparation.",
"summary": {
"idle": "Lancez une vérification de l'état des paramètres, de l'intégrité du cache et de la cohérence de l'interface.",
"ok": "Aucun problème actif n'a été trouvé dans l'environnement actuel.",
"warning": "{count} problème(s) ont été trouvés. La plupart peuvent être corrigés directement depuis ce panneau.",
"error": "{count} problème(s) nécessitent une attention avant que l'application soit entièrement saine."
},
"status": {
"ok": "Sain",
"warning": "Nécessite une attention",
"error": "Action requise"
},
"actions": {
"runAgain": "Relancer",
"exportBundle": "Exporter le lot"
},
"toast": {
"loadFailed": "Échec du chargement des diagnostics : {message}",
"repairSuccess": "Reconstruction du cache terminée.",
"repairFailed": "Échec de la reconstruction du cache : {message}",
"exportSuccess": "Lot de diagnostics exporté.",
"exportFailed": "Échec de l'export du lot de diagnostics : {message}"
}
},
"banners": {
"versionMismatch": {
"title": "Mise à jour de l'application détectée",